37 America's Most Wanted plastered large across bus in Washington DC (twitter.com) posted 2 years ago by xleb2 2 years ago by xleb2 +37 / -0 6 comments share 6 comments share save hide report block hide replies
Looks to be Robert Kadlic. Never heard of him before today, though.
Oh my god no wonder
Such prescient timing.